Say I have two boxes of type Int64_box:
box1 with one dimension, A->[1,1]
box2 of two dimensions, A -> [10,10], B->[4,4]
For example, let us analyze the merge point in the end of the snippet
int a,b,c,d
if (?) {A=1}
else {A=10; B=4;}
I use Int64_box as abstract domains, so that the if- part and else- part give box1 and box2 as shown above. To reason about the merge point, I use add_dimension_and_embed before upper_bound_assign. But that will extend box1 to A->[1,1],B->[-inf,+inf] so that the upper_bound_assign will give A->[1,10], B->[-inf,+inf].
I realize that what I really wanted was to expand box1 to
A->[1,1], B->empty
so that the box1 joined with box2 gives A->[1,10], B->[4,4]
I don't see how to extend box1 in that way, because if one dimension is empty, the whole int64_box becomes empty as well, which seems to be reasonable but does not go with my above example.

Consider the domain D:= Var-> Interval, where "Interval" contains two special intervals, " Empty " and " Universe " . I am now using Int_64 from PPL to model this domain. However I feel confused when I need to represent elements that " mixes the 'Empty' and 'Universe' " . One such element is, { x->[3,5], y->[4,7], z->empty, w->universe}.
I find that, whenever a constraint like "z->empty" is added to a constraints_system, the constraints_system becomes "false". This seems reasonable because the constraint_system in PPL models a conjunction of constraints and thus one constraint is false make the whole constraint system unsatisfiable. However, I do not see how to represent elements like the one given above that mixes 'z->Empty' and 'w->Universe' . ( I would like to use 'z->empty' to mean 'z is not yet initialized', and 'w->universe' to mean that 'w is unknown' .)
